Add packages: write permission to update-registry job to allow the nested registry-build workflow to build CI images for provider registry. The permission is scoped at the job level following least privilege to fix the zizmor errors if done globally.

Backport failed to create: v3-1-test. View the failure log Run details

Note: As of Merging PRs targeted for Airflow 3.X
the committer who merges the PR is responsible for backporting the PRs that are bug fixes (generally speaking) to the maintenance branches.

In matter of doubt please ask in #release-management Slack channel.

Status Branch Result
v3-1-test Commit Link

You can attempt to backport this manually by running:

cherry_picker 8f73a7e v3-1-test

This should apply the commit to the v3-1-test branch and leave the commit in conflict state marking
the files that need manual conflict resolution.

After you have resolved the conflicts, you can continue the backport process by running:

cherry_picker --continue
